Sam Odell completed his second season as the head coach of the Shepherd women’s soccer program after being named the head coach in April 2021.
In 2022, Odell led the Rams to a 7-7-4 record, just narrowly missing out on the playoffs and recorded the team’s best finish in the PSAC since moving from the MEC in 2019. In two seasons, Odell and his coaching staff have improved the team’s performance from a 1-15-2 record in 2019 to 7-7-4 this past fall.
Odell has mentored Sara Hohn, a two-time All-PSAC East second team selection. Additionally, Shepherd had Delaney Bittner, Paris Kimbrell, Madison Michael, Alyssa Nazarok,  Myra Striebig, and Hohn garner 2022 CSC Academic All-District honors. Nazarok was also named a finalist for the 2021 Truman Scholarship by the Harry S. Truman Scholarship Foundation. Bittner (first team) and Hohn (third team) became the program's first Academic All-Americans.
Odell spent two seasons as an assistant coach for the Rams between 2019 and 2020 and was the interim head coach during the spring season of 2021. 
A native of Walton-on-Thames, England, Odell is a 2018 graduate of Caldwell College where he was a four-year member of the men’s soccer team from 2014-17. He gained All-Conference honors as a midfielder, and was named to the CACC All-Tournament Team in 2015 and 2016. Odell played at Portsmouth Football Club’s FA accredited Academy from age 11-18 in his youth career prior to playing in the U.S. During his time at Portsmouth he played against the top academies in the U.K Academy System including teams such as Arsenal and Chelsea, as well as players who are now England internationals such as Raheem Sterling and Luke Shaw. 
Odell has an extensive coaching background with many years of developing players at the elite club level with both female and male age groups. 
Odell holds numerous coaching qualifications including an Advanced National Diploma (United Soccer Coaches), ISPAS Level 1 Accreditation (International Society of Performance Analysis of Sport), Goalkeeper Level 1 Diploma (United Soccer Coaches), and Futsal Level 1 Diploma (United Soccer Coaches). He also holds a USSF D License (United States Soccer Federation) and a Sports Performance Diploma from (United Soccer Coaches).  
Odell earned a bachelor’s degree in sports management from Caldwell in 2018 and graduated with an MBA from Shepherd in 2021.
